Ticket #— Floor 9 Opening Prep, Brindlemoor House

Hi facilities folks, Floor 9 opens to staff next Monday and we need a few things squared away before then. Lift access is live, but the two side doors by the kitchenette are still on the old lock config — please reprogram them before Friday. Also, signage for the quiet rooms hasn't arrived, so pop up the temporary printed ones for now. Until the badge readers sync, the interim door code for Floor 9 is below.

door code, bajop-bajog: bdg-DSWAC-43621

### Ticket: Sweeper config drift on prod

Folks, the orphaned-resource sweeper (Tidewrack) on the Galloway cluster has drifted from what's in source control again. It's been skipping stale volumes for about a week, so storage costs are creeping up. Probably someone hot-patched it during the outage and never backported. Until we reconcile, please don't hand-edit anything else. For reference, the values it should be running with are listed below.

deployment values, tagug-tagaf:
[zorix]
team = druix
access_code = ac_42e3e2
host = zorix.qirvancorp.test
port = 6379
owner = beldor.gordor
peer = kelath.zemvarcorp.test

**Meeting notes — Restock Planner sync, Thursday**

Quick recap for support: the Snackroute restock planner now recalculates routes nightly instead of hourly, so drivers won't see mid-day route shuffles anymore. If a machine reports empty but isn't on tomorrow's route, that's expected — it queues for the next cycle. Manual overrides still work from the dispatcher view. We're watching for double-visit complaints through Friday. Anything weird, don't guess — route it straight to the person below.

named custodian: Brivan Eliath Quenox Frador

Subject: Visitor Procedure — Arden Quay Front Desk

Dear contractor, on arrival please sign the visitor register, present photo identification, and wait in the lobby until your host collects you. Badges must be worn visibly at all times and returned before leaving. If the desk is unattended, use the courtesy phone to reach your host. The lobby inner door opens with the code below.

door code, yagap-bahof: bdg-O-05